Elana Feinstein

7th Grade English Teacher at Heschel Day School

Elana Feinstein is an experienced educator currently serving as a 7th Grade English Teacher at Heschel Day School since August 2022. Previous roles include teaching 7th and 8th Grade English at Sinai Akiba Academy, where responsibilities encompassed being an 8th Grade Advisor, supervising Student Council, and implementing innovative instructional strategies focused on social justice and mindfulness from July 2020 to August 2022. Prior teaching experiences include positions at Woodside High School, Bloomington High School North, Medora Community School, and Park View Montessori Preschool, where Elana developed diverse curricula and employed technology to enhance student engagement and academic success. Elana holds a Bachelor's Degree in Secondary Language Arts Education from Indiana University Bloomington and has also contributed to professional development initiatives within educational districts.
